6. File naming conventions
File naming conventions straight affect the visibility of information inside the Android working system. A number one dot (“.”) prepended to a file or folder title designates it as hidden. This conference is acknowledged by the Android system, inflicting the working system to hide this stuff from commonplace view in most file managers. Consequently, the “easy methods to see hidden information android” process hinges on understanding and overriding this naming conference. A file that might ordinarily be seen turns into hidden just by renaming it to incorporate a number one dot. The significance of this lies within the system’s reliance on file names to find out visibility standing, unbiased of the file’s content material or sort. An actual-life instance is the creation of a “.nomedia” file inside a listing to forestall picture gallery purposes from scanning and displaying media information in that listing. Renaming the file to “nomedia” restores regular visibility, illustrating the influence of naming conventions on file entry.
Additional evaluation reveals the conference’s influence on utility habits. Android purposes usually make the most of hidden directories (folders that start with a dot) to retailer configuration information, cache knowledge, or application-specific settings. These directories stay hidden by default to forestall unintended modification by the person, which may result in utility instability or knowledge loss. Modifying the visibility of such information by both renaming them or altering the settings of the file supervisor, requires a fundamental understanding of file naming conventions. System-generated information, like `.thumbnails` positioned inside picture directories, are robotically created and hidden by the system. Such information retailer picture thumbnails to speed up media searching, and could be revealed utilizing the appropriate file supervisor settings and/or understanding of the file naming conventions.

Important Methods
Getting access to hidden information on Android units requires a scientific method and an understanding of underlying file administration rules. The next ideas present steering on attaining this job whereas minimizing potential dangers.
Tip 1: Choose a Succesful File Supervisor: Not all file supervisor purposes provide the power to show usually invisible information. Select a file supervisor recognized for its superior options, corresponding to Strong Explorer, MiXplorer, or Complete Commander. Make sure the chosen utility features a clearly labeled “present hidden information” choice inside its settings.
Tip 2: Navigate to the Settings Menu: Find the settings menu inside the file supervisor. The situation of this menu varies relying on the appliance. It’s usually discovered beneath a “menu” icon (three horizontal traces or dots) or inside a devoted “settings” part.
Tip 3: Allow “Present Hidden Recordsdata”: Throughout the settings menu, find the choice labeled “present hidden information,” “show hidden information,” or the same phrase. Toggle this feature to the “on” place. The applying will then refresh its listing listings, revealing usually hid information and folders.
Tip 4: Perceive File Naming Conventions: Acknowledge that information and folders with names starting with a dot (“.”) are designated as hidden. These information usually include configuration settings or utility knowledge. Keep away from modifying or deleting these information except their function is clearly understood.
Tip 5: Train Warning with System Recordsdata: Whereas displaying usually invisible information could be helpful, modifying or deleting system information can destabilize the working system. Proceed with excessive warning and keep away from making adjustments to information positioned in system directories (e.g., `/system`, `/knowledge`) except possessing superior technical data.
Tip 6: Take into account Root Entry (If Needed): For entry to protected system information, root entry could also be required. Nevertheless, rooting a tool voids warranties and introduces safety dangers. Proceed with rooting provided that completely vital and possess the technical experience to mitigate potential points.
Tip 7: Make the most of Anti-Malware Software program: After enabling the show of usually invisible information, scan the machine with a good anti-malware utility. This measure helps detect and take away any malicious information which will have been hid.
